Exam Format and Topics
The June 2014 Trig Regents exam typically includes a variety of question types designed
to test students’ grasp of trigonometric principles such as:
**Right triangle trigonometry:** Calculating side lengths and angles using sine,
cosine, and tangent.
**Unit circle concepts:** Understanding radians, degrees, and their relationships.
**Graphing trig functions:** Analyzing transformations and periodicity.
**Trigonometric identities:** Proving and applying identities to simplify expressions.
**Applications:** Solving real-world problems involving angles of elevation,
navigation, and waves.
